Transaction 4dfe6816c2f884eb113f76be773649a8bda72a0de691aae99b18cae97f15ed53
1 Input
1 Output
-
4dfe6816c2f884eb113f76be773649a8bda72a0de691aae99b18cae97f15ed53:0
- value
- 585858
- script pubkey
- OP_0 OP_PUSHBYTES_20 50c62bd5f02b3a9133ff072065c388977ccf417f
- address
- bc1q2rrzh40s9vafzvllqusxtsugja7v7stlsr0e4e